Rep. Kennedy, alongside President Trump, intends to impose higher costs on companies seeking to use the H-1B visa program in order to address the abuse of the program, stop the undercutting of wages, and protect our national security.
Evidence
GovInfo lists H.R. 8335 as introduced by Mr. Kennedy of Utah and referred to the House Judiciary Committee on April 16, 2026. The full title says the bill would amend the Immigration and Nationality Act to reform the H-1B nonimmigrant visa program, with exceptions for certain vital professions.
Kennedy's official House release says he introduced the PROTECT Act of 2026 to address abuse of the H-1B program, raise the H-1B visa fee to $100,000, stop wage undercutting, and protect national security.
Assessments
Kennedy took same-term legislative action by introducing H.R. 8335, the PROTECT Act of 2026, to reform the H-1B visa program and tie that reform to wage protection and national security. But the record only shows introduction and referral to committee, not enactment or implementation. Because the broader promised outcome was to fix the legal immigration system, and the cited action addresses only one legal-immigration program without becoming law, this counts as a serious effort rather than delivered fulfillment.
